Inspected 22 June 2022 · report published 11 August 2022What inspectors found
This inspection report for Woodland Court Residential Home covers key aspects of the service provided, offering a detailed overview for families considering this care option. The inspectors focused on how safe, effective, caring, responsive, and well-led the home is, aiming to provide assurance about the quality of care. Overall findings suggest a service that strives to meet the needs of its residents.
Regarding safety, residents and their families generally feel secure, with systems in place to protect against abuse. Staff are knowledgeable about safeguarding procedures, and adequate staffing levels contribute to a safe environment. The home also maintains robust emergency plans and ensures proper medication management and infection control practices are followed.
In terms of how effective the care is, residents are supported by staff who know them well, and their independence and choices are promoted. Care plans are detailed and reflect a person-centred approach.
For caring interactions, staff are described as enthusiastic, showing care and understanding towards residents. This positive attitude contributes to a supportive atmosphere within the home.
When considering responsiveness, while most residents' needs are well met, some families noted that communication regarding care plans could be more proactive. However, many also reported good communication and involvement in their relative's care.
Finally, on how well-led the service is, the management is seen as approachable and supportive by staff, fostering a positive culture. While not all relatives are aware of the registered manager by name, those who are offer positive feedback. The home has effective quality monitoring systems, though improved consistency in communication with families is an area for continued focus.
